MESSAGE FROM H.E. MIYON LEE, AMBASSADOR OF THE REPUBLIC OF KOREA, ON THE OCCASION OF KOREA'S NATIONAL FOUNDATION DAY 2025

As the Ambassador of the Republic of Korea to Sri Lanka, I am honored to celebrate Korea's 4358th National Foundation Day -(개천절), Gaecheonjeol) on October 3 with the people of the Democratic Socialist Republic of Sri Lanka.
-
This year's commemoration carries special significance, as it also marks the 80th anniversary of Korea's Liberation in 1945 after the World War II. These dual milestones highlight both the depth of Korea's ancient history and the modern journey of the Republic, reminding us of the sacrifices made by our forefathers to gain freedom and promote democracy.
Korea's modern journey has been shaped by challenges, but also by determination at every crucial moment. In December last year, the Korean people fought back the declaration of emergency martial law and reaffirmed the strength of civic responsibility. The peaceful presidential election in June 2025 and the inauguration of Lee Jae Myung Administration has demonstrated the resilience and maturity of Korea's democratic system. The new administration has announced 123 national policy tasks, which include strengthening democratic governance, advancing inclusive development, and working toward the peaceful resolution of relations with North Korea through dialogue and cooperation.
Korea draws similarities with Sri Lanka, which experienced “Aragalaya” in 2022 and one of the most peaceful and democratic transition of power in the nation's history. As a democratic partner, I would like to take this opportunity to thank Sri Lanka for its trust and support rendered to Korean people when our democracy was under threat. These shared experiences and mutual understanding make our friendship even more special.
This year marks the 48th anniversary of diplomatic relations between Korea and Sri Lanka. Over nearly half a century, our two nations have cultivated a partnership built on deep and lasting connections.
